Since my college days, I have been deeply motivated to create meaningful impact within the social and community development space. To contribute to this vision, I joined Vocal for Local Ranchi as a core team member an initiative recognized by various government bodies for its work toward empowering underprivileged children and supporting local businesses.
Guided by the belief that local talent deserves a larger platform, I conceptualized and led the planning of “Startup Mela,” a two-day state-level event designed to showcase homegrown brands and startups. The event drew over 10,000 visitors, becoming one of Ranchi’s most successful community-driven initiatives a testament to the power of collaboration and local entrepreneurship.
